The 2023 Chrysler 300 is offered with a 3.6-liter V6 producing 292 hp engine, a 5.7-liter V8 producing 363 hp, or a 6.4-liter V8 producing 485 hp engine. Standard equipment includes a rear-wheel drive and automatic eight-speed transmission, while all-wheel drive is reserved for the V6 engine.
Although the V6-powered models might not fetch the first prize in a drag race, they are more than capable of handling the demands of daily commutes. With the eight-speed transmission's rapid but smooth shifts, the sedan can get up to speed quickly and make quick passing moves on the highway. It takes around 6.5 seconds to make the sprint to 60 miles per hour. Yet, in order to make the most of the engine’s power, this V6 (called a "Pentastar" by Chrysler) needs to be revved to high levels.
The Hemi V8 engines solve this problem, but their poor gas mileage is a drawback. When prompted, these motors produce soft burbles and roars from the tailpipes and propel the vehicle with brisk authority. Chrysler claims the 300C's 6.4-liter V8 can accelerate the car from 0-60 mph in 4.3 seconds.
